dc.description.abstract | Effective management of perishable inventory presents a significant challenge for
businesses like coffee chains. This thesis explores the use of demand forecasting techniques
and inventory optimization to minimize waste and maximize profitability. The study
proposes a system design that leverages Time series forecasting techniques for accurate
demand forecasting of perishable coffee products. The system then utilizes the FEFO (First
Expired, First Out) policy for inventory management, recommending optimal order
quantities based on the forecasts. The proposed approach offers several benefits: reduced
spoilage of perishable products, improved profitability through minimized waste and
optimized ordering, enhanced customer satisfaction via consistent product availability, and
data-driven decision making for inventory management. | en_US |
